Qualifying Sessions
Qualifying is where the riders fight for their spot on the grid. The grid position determines the starting order for the main race. The higher up the grid, the better the starting position, and the higher the chances of a good race result. It is a high-pressure competition. The qualifying sessions take place on Saturday afternoon and are divided into two main parts: Q1 and Q2. The top riders from Q2 will fight for the pole position. Live Television Broadcasts
Live television broadcasts are a classic way to watch MotoGP. TV broadcasts provide in-depth coverage. These broadcasts usually offer expert commentary, behind-the-scenes insights, and analysis of the race. Typically, the main broadcasting channel in the UK for MotoGP is BT Sport. BT Sport provides live coverage of all MotoGP races, qualifying sessions, and practice sessions. It is the go-to channel for many MotoGP fans in the UK. The coverage includes pre-race build-up, live race coverage, and post-race analysis. You can enjoy watching the race, as well as the race analysis from the commentators.
